Why Live in Seaport

Seaport, a neighborhood in Stockton, features a mix of early 20th-century Craftsman bungalows and midcentury ranch-style homes, particularly in its eastern portion. These homes often have small front porches, grassy backyards, and one to two carports. The southern part of Seaport showcases larger, late 20th-century ranch-style homes with wrought iron or chain-link fences and rock-landscaped gardens. Newer subdivisions like Bella Terra at River Breeze and Aspire at River Terrace offer two-story traditional homes with two-car garages. Residents enjoy local features such as Mattie Harrell Park, which provides open green space for picnics and sports, and the Edible Schoolyard Community Farm, which hosts educational gardening events. The Morelli Park Boat Launch and Stockton Downtown Marina offer boating and waterfront activities along the San Joaquin River. Dining options include Betto’s Birrieria Taqueria and Eddie’s Pizza Café, while El Dorado Market is a popular spot for groceries. The Stockton Flea Market, held every weekend, is a significant local event with over 300 vendors. Seaport is accessible via Interstate 5 and California State Route 4, with bike lanes on major roads and bus services from the San Joaquin Regional Transit District. The neighborhood is zoned for the Stockton Unified School District, with George Washington Elementary and Edison High School serving local students. The University of the Pacific, a highly regarded private university, is located 5 miles north.
